Typical Alsatian restaurant offering generous portions in Strasbourg.
The Schnockeloch, literally "the mosquito hole", is typically Alsatian: smoked palette on sauerkraut, grilled knuckle of ham with munster cheese, poultry blanquette, fish sauerkraut, pork cheeks... The plates are carefully prepared and the team is friendly and welcoming. We love the chic decor without being stuffy, and the superb panoramic view of the city from the second floor, particularly pleasant in the evening. Located halfway between the station and the city center, the Schnockeloch is a good stopping-off point for tourists and locals alike.
